The National Institute of Technology in Delhi, i.e., thrust in the public sector along with private one is the leading engineering institute in India. It was founded in 2010, the primary objective of which being to render training of high quality technical standards and also carry out innovative research studies. NIT Delhi gives opportunities for undergraduate and postgraduate research across the full range of engineering disciplines including Electrical, Computer Science, Electronics, Mechanical and Biotechnology. The institute is very resourceful with large library, workshops, auditoriums and multi-purpose sporting facilities placed on a 50 acres campus.

NIT Delhi Eligibility Criteria 2024
1. Educational Qualification
It is necessary to qualify 10+2 or equivalent exam with at least 75% aggregate marks in Physics, Chemistry and Mathematics.
2. Age Limit
There is no upper age limit for getting into NIT Delhi.
3. Entrance Exams
You got to appear in the JEE Main examination, which is conducted by the National Testing Agency (NTA). Based on your JEE Main ranks, you can select the counselling process for admission.
4. Subjects Required
You would need Physics, Chemistry and Mathematics at 10+2 level. Some of the programs would require you to have other subjects too.
5. Number of Attempts
The number of JEE Main exam attempts is not restricted. However, your age may not comply with the age criterion of the course duration.
6. Reservation
As per the Government of India rules, reservation is allotted to SC/ST/OBC/PWD candidates. Certificates required for availing reservation facilities.
7. Counselling
In case of the qualification for counselling as per JEE Main rankings, the process will be followed by document verification and choice filling. Seat is allocated based on merit, choice and availability.

NIT Delhi Placements 2024
One of the very best NITs in India and with outstanding placement records is NIT Delhi. In the academic year of 2023-2024, the ratio of students who were placed after undergoing the placements is more than 92%, with average salary being Rs.11 LPA. The top recruiters are the likes of Microsoft, Amazon, Google, Texas Instruments, Samsung, Flipkart, and Intel. Students land up in IT/software roles apart from companies in the core engineering sectors like consultancy, analytics, chip design, construction, automobile sectors, etc.
